## Alert: Bulk Edit Anomaly — Admin Table

This alert fires when a single session issues more than 500 row updates in the Corvane admin table within one minute. It most often indicates a misconfigured bulk-edit script rather than abuse, but unreviewed mass changes have previously corrupted pricing data. Verify the session owner, confirm a change ticket exists, and if none does, suspend the session and notify the data integrity team.

escalation mailbox, bafog-fafog: ulador@paliqlabs.internal

## Queue Autoscaler — quick orientation

Welcome aboard! The Drainpipe autoscaler watches queue depth on the Fenwick job broker and adds workers when the backlog crosses a threshold. It's touchy: scale-up is fast, scale-down is deliberately slow, so don't panic if workers linger after a spike. If you need to tune it, edit the staging profile first and let it soak for an hour. Here are the current autoscaler settings.

deployment values, yadug-bawif:
[framir]
team = pelox
access_code = ac_a38ab2
owner = tamion.julael
host = framir.tolvaqlabs.test
port = 11211
peer = tammir.zemvargrid.local
salt = 2215ef03
pin = 1541

Subject: Handover — stale-cache postmortem

For the weekly sync: the Marrowfield stale-cache postmortem is done. Root cause was a skipped purge on config reload; fix shipped in 4.2.6, monitoring added. Action items assigned, two still open. Rollout completes Thursday. Note we rotated signing as part of remediation — verify all new artifacts with the key below.

signing key of bagap-yawep = bky13_TbfT6ZMUoGJo2

TICKET DOCS-517 — Linter eats fenced blocks, team mildly annoyed

Heads-up for the sync: the Quibble docs linter started flagging perfectly fine code fences as "unclosed block" whenever a fence sits inside a blockquote. Root cause looks like the new markdown parser we pulled in last Tuesday — it tokenizes the quote marker before the fence and loses state. About 40 pages in the Harrowgate handbook are affected, so CI is red for anyone touching docs. Fix is small; review's up. The regression first appeared in the build noted below.

pipeline stamp: htk9_b3279b371